Job Summary:

Lead. Build. Maintain Excellence.

The Arizona Department of Corrections, Rehabilitation & Reentry (ADCRR) is seeking a skilled Physical Plant Administrator to oversee facility operations and maintenance at ASPC-Lewis.

In this key role, you’ll manage building systems, equipment, and infrastructure—including surveillance, refrigeration, sewage, and water systems. You’ll plan and direct repairs, renovations, and new construction while overseeing budgets, cost estimates, and maintenance programs. Strong leadership and technical expertise are essential as you guide and develop a dedicated maintenance team to ensure safe, efficient, and high-quality operations.

Job Duties:

-Oversees the Physical Plant Operations by ensuring a preventative maintenance system is in place for equipment and buildings
-Prepares cost estimates and budget requests regarding maintenance issues and large projects
-Reviews projects and makes design recommendations
-Ensures a Work Order system is in place for all maintenance issues, from submission to completion by staff
-Approves material and equipment orders for the Physical Plant
-Schedules maintenance and construction activities to ensure rapid completion of projects
-Drives on State business
-Performs other duties appropriate to the assignment

Selective Preference(s):

-A Bachelor’s degree from an accredited college or university or technical school with a degree in engineering and one year of supervisory or administrative experience directing the operation and maintenance of a large physical plant, building, or multi-building complex, requiring a working knowledge of the application of National Emergency Management (NEMA), Occupational Safety Health Administration (OHA), and city codes.

Pre-Employment Requirements:

Employment is contingent on the selected applicant passing a background investigation, drug test, and a medical/physical examination.
